Job description
Overview

To report to the Manager or team leader as shown in the organization chart. They are responsible for the assigned or related project tasks and responsibilities.


Responsibilities


  • Study and fully understand the ISO requirements, technical drawings, scope, contractual requirements and sub-contract agreements. Work with the consultants to resolve technical issues prior to construction.

  • Submit to superior for feedback and concurrence on short or medium-term programmes and execute the works according to the detailed programme.

  • Ensure that the works are carried out according to the approved drawings, quality procedures and EHS requirements. Managing the works with excellent housekeeping is a key focus.

  • For quality management, the engineer is responsible to fully implement with the quality recordings, carry out result analysis and formulate action plans for continuous improvement.

  • Implement and maintain proper recordings to comply with EHS, quality, client and authorities’ requirements.

  • Responsible for cost management so that the materials used for both temporary works and permanent works are not damaged or control the wastage within specified tolerance. Rework or abortive work which has serious time and cost impacts shall be avoided.

  • Ad-hoc matters as assigned by the PM which is necessary for the execution of the project.


Job Requirements


  • Bachelor's Degree in Mechanical or Electrical engineering

  • Minimum 5 years’ of experience in site works and have handled main contractors’ technical coordination like ERSS, precast coordination, structural coordination, facilities planning

  • Have experience in commercial projects
